What is holding back the development of antiviral metallodrugs? A literature overview and implications for SARS-CoV-2 therapeutics and future viral outbreaks

2020 
In light of the Covid-19 outbreak, this review brings the historical and current literature efforts towards the development of antiviral metallodrugs. Classical compounds such as CTC-96 and auranofin are discussed in depth as pillars for future metallodrugs development. From the recent literature, both cell-based results and biophysical assays against potential viral biomolecule targets are summarized here. Biomolecular interactions are emphasized as a as a powerful and fundamental understanding that will foment further development of metal-based antivirals. We also discuss other possible and unexplored methods for unveiling metallodrugs interactions with biomolecules related to viral replication and highlight the specific challenges involved in the development of antiviral metallodrugs.
